The mechanism underlying the anti-obesity effects of tesofensine was assessed in a DIO rat version (Axel et al., 2010). Therapy with tesofensine (2 mg/kg, SC) for 16 days reduced daily food intake (49%) and generated weight management (14%), contrasted to automobile. Intense tesofensine (0.5-- 3 mg/kg; SC) dose-dependently reduced food intake, with an ED50 of 1.3 mg/kg.

Studies have suggested that the tesofensine dose variety used was in between 0.25 mg to 1 mg. Nonetheless, the weight-loss achieved with a 0.5 mg dosage (9.2%) was only slightly lower than that of a 1 mg dose (10.6%). Considering the dose-dependent increase in adverse effects, it raises questions concerning the justifiability of higher dosages.

Weight problems wasnot identified as a chronic condition till 1985 by the clinical community and2013 by the medical neighborhood. Pharmacotherapy for obesity has advancedremarkably because the first-rate of medicines, amphetamines, were approved forshort-term use. The majority of amphetamines were eliminated from the obesity market due toadverse events and potential for addiction, and it became apparent that obesitypharmacotherapies were needed that might safely be administered over thelong-term. This testimonial of central nerve system (CNS) acting anti-obesity drugsevaluates present therapies such as phentermine/topiramate which act throughmultiple neurotransmitter pathways to lower cravings.
